MEAT LOST TO BRSTAIN
QUEENSLAND STRIKE Beceived Friday, 7 p.m. CAXBEK RA, July 12. The Queenslaiul meat strike has redueed the export of meat to Britain by about 25,(100 1ons, according to the Minister of Gommerce and Agriculture, Alr. Scullv. lie said tliat the Queens- j land killiug season would be extended J to late Septeniber or earlv October to enalde about 10,000 tons of the de(icit to lie made up. Queensland meat authorities de- j scribed this statement as " colossal | ignoranee" and said that nothiug the i Federal Government could do would ex- 1 tend what was left of the Killiug season j beyoiwl the period in which there were j cattlo available to be slaughtered. It was unlikelv that anv ealtle which had I lost condition through del;ived killiug would rccovor it in timo to be killed )>efore or during Septeniber.
